The Opportunity 

Our Government & Public Sector (G&PS) practice is at the forefront of shaping India's urban future. We are seeking a creative and analytical Senior Associate with a background in architecture and urban planning to join our dynamic Urban & Housing Advisory team. 

This role is for a professional who can bridge the gap between physical design and strategic policy. You will be a key member of our project teams, contributing your technical planning expertise to high-impact government advisory engagements. You will help shape sustainable, livable, and economically viable urban spaces for communities across the country. 

Responsibilities 

  • Conceptualization & Master Planning: 

  • Develop innovative Concept Plans, master plans, and layout designs for large-scale housing, townships, and urban development projects. 

  • Translate strategic objectives into tangible spatial plans and design frameworks. 

  • Technical & Feasibility Assessment: 

  • Prepare Block Cost Estimates and preliminary financial assessments for projects to determine initial viability and scale. 

  • Conduct comprehensive Demand Assessments for housing, commercial, and mixed-use developments to inform project scope and design. 

  • Policy & Strategic Advisory: 

  • Apply a strong understanding of the key initiatives and schemes of the Ministry of Housing and Urban Affairs (MoHUA) (e.g., Smart Cities Mission, AMRUT, PMAY-Urban, etc.) to client projects. 

  • Support the development of Vision Plans, City Development Plans (CDPs), and long-term Urban Development Strategies for government clients. (Prior experience in this area will be an added advantage). 

  • Project Support & Reporting: 

  • Exhibit excellent report writing skills by authoring and contributing to high-quality project reports, feasibility studies, and client presentations. 

  • Effectively support the supervisory team by providing robust technical analysis, managing specific workstreams, and ensuring the timely delivery of project milestones. 

  •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ams, including financial analysts, PPP experts, and policy specialists. 

Qualifications & Experience 

  • Education: A Bachelor's degree in Architecture (B.Arch) AND a Master's degree in Urban Planning (M.Plan) or a related field from a premier institution is mandatory. 

  • Experience: 4 to 5 years of professional experience in the Urban and Housing sector. 

  • Domain Expertise: Demonstrable experience working on Government projects related to Urban Development, Housing Development, and Real Estate Development. 

Required Skills & Competencies 

Areas of Expertise (Must-Have): 

  • Urban Planning: Proven ability to develop concept plans and master plans. Proficiency in relevant design and planning software (e.g., AutoCAD, GIS) is essential. 

  • Cost Estimation: Experience in preparing block-level or preliminary cost estimates for urban projects. 

  • Demand & Market Analysis: Skills in conducting demand assessments and market studies for real estate and housing. 

  • Government Schemes & Policies: Strong familiarity with the programs, policies, and guidelines of MoHUA and other relevant government bodies.
